What Exactly Is a Loft Style Apartment?
Apartments come in many varieties. Among these, the so-called ‘Loft Apartment’ usually features higher ceilings, and larger windows, and frequently includes industrial design elements.

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 76308?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 76308 Studio Apartments | $515 | $515 | $515 |
| 76308 1 Bedroom Apartments | $843 | $585 | $1,460 |
| 76308 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,005 | $640 | $1,740 |
| 76308 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,265 | $530 | $1,825 |
| 76308 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,407 | $1,407 | $1,407 |
